Terrorists operating in the Jibiya Forest of Katsina State, have again launched an attack on Kukar Babangida Village, located along the Jibiya-Katsina Road, killing one, abducting a housewife and rustling an unspecified number of animals.
According to a source in the area, the attack occurred at about 10:30 pm on June 2, when the terrorists in their numbers, stormed the village, shooting sporadically.
It was gathered that the terrorists killed one trader called Sani Ladidi, who is also known as Sani Iska, while a woman, Hafsat Isuhu Sansere, was abducted, after rustling the animals belonging to her husband, Isuhu Sansere.
The source further added that normalcy has since returned to the village, but members of the community, are living in fear.
The latest attack on Kukar Babangida is coming less than 3 days after a similar one was carried out on ‘Mile Takwas,’ Customs Checkpoint, along the same Jibiya-Katsina Road, where 3 of their Operational Vehicles were burnt, while one person sustained gunshot injury.
